How to choose a rescuer

  • Insurance current. GL, auto, workers comp.
  • DOT-compliant if they're towing or running service trucks over CDL weight.
  • 24/7 dispatch with a real human, not a callback queue.
  • Transparent pricing, you should get a confirmed dispatch fee before the truck rolls.
  • Local, a service truck 60 miles away isn't going to beat the regional benchmark.
